To Romo or Not to Romo?

That is the question this week as many folks in and around the National Football League speculate on the future of current Dallas Cowboy quarterback Tony Romo. If he is indeed released by Dallas, the rumors continue to point toward Denver as possible destination for the 36-year old signal caller. And based on the online fan feedback, there doesn't seem to be a lot of love for the idea. Should Denver go after the oft-injured veteran? Absolutely. Hang with me a second Broncos Country. Yes. He's Romo. He's the dude who couldn't hold the ball for an extra point try. He's the one who has the injured reserve on speed dial. He's old. And for crying out loud he's a freaking Cowboy! But Tony Romo is also a really, really good quarterback when he's healthy. A healthy Romo is flat out better than the youthful tandem of Trevor Siemian and Paxton Lynch.
